Allt Nytt | Kalender | Racerbanor | Arrangörer | Forum | Varvtider/Loggar |
Om hård- och mjukvara för loggning & video RejsaCAN datorkort 3x5cm, CAN-bus, 12V, bluetooth, WiFi | << 1, 2, 3, 4 >> 2 besök senaste veckan (2964 totalt) |
Låter extremt troligt _________________ Magnus Thomé |
||||||||
En tankevurpa på korten v2.1 och v2.2. Lätt fixat dock. Men som de är nu så om man drar GPIO25 för FORCE_ON hög så att kortet fortsätter vara igång även när spänningen sjunker under 13V när bilens motor slutar ladda bilbatteriet så kan man inte läsa av GPIO14 som visar om motorn är igång eller inte. Den är tyvärr hög hela tiden när FORCE_ON är hög. Urpuckat...
Om man inte använder FORCE_ON för att hålla igång kortet på lägre spänningar så är det inga problem och kan lämnas därhän. Lätt fixat med en diod inlödd i de två hålen för AUTO-OFF, PM om ni vill ha en diod eller skriv här om ni vill veta nåt mera _________________ Magnus Thomé |
||||||||
Det enda jag nu verkar behöva få tag på, innan jag sätter igång med mitt nästa projekt, är en större matris som kan göra mera av en AR upplevd HUD....
AR enligt MB, en dryg minut in... _________________ Lars H Bamsefar kan vara närmare än du tror.... |
||||||||
Rejsa-can uppmärksammat av blogger/"influencer" i SBC-träsket
https://www.cnx-software.com/2022/01 _________________ /mvh Stefan Björklund Fear is lack of knowledge. Your problem, my profit! F1-bärgare |
||||||||
Det står att man kan utöka antalet CAN-portar med en MCP2515, hur många kan man lägga till? Var orkar professorn med? tänker om man skall plocka paket från ett antal bussar med olika hastighet och bygga en egen ström som man skickar vidare, orkar den med det? Kanske enklare att ha flera rejsaCAN-kort som man kopplar ihop? _________________ /Mats Strandberg onemanracing.com BMW 330i -05 |
||||||||
_________________ Magnus Thomé |
||||||||
Lite nöjd, lyckades hacka runt i koden för ESP32RET så att den funkar på S3-varianten av ESP32. Dvs funkar rakt av på v3.x av RejsaCAN som ju har ESP32-S3.
https://github.com/MagnusThome/ESP32 Den ger både en enklare ELM327-emulering (provkörde mot Torque Androidappen lite kort igår) och ännu bättre, det ska gå att köra savvycan mot S3-baserade korten också www.savvycan.com _________________ Magnus Thomé |
||||||||
La upp den här som jag bara använt som testverktyg att kolla att kort faktiskt funkar
https://github.com/MagnusThome/ESP32 Funkar med alla sorters ESP32-kort _________________ Magnus Thomé |
||||||||
Sen "forkade" jag och skrev om kod så att man väldigt enkelt kan hämta OBD2-data utan att behöva lära sig den underliggande CAN-delen
https://github.com/MagnusThome/esp32 Exempel: https://github.com/MagnusThome/esp32 Funkar med alla sorters ESP32-kort _________________ Magnus Thomé |
||||||||
Japp, drivs antingen av usb eller via externa 13,5V minimum (=motorn är igång o generatorn laddar) Och ja det finns en led som visar att den rullat igång oavsett om det är via usb eller bilen så att säga. Båda kan vara inkopplade utan problem. Tänk på jordslingor bara om du kör usb till dator som är jordad i bilen. Edit: Finns äldre versioner av kortet (v2.4 och äldre) som har USB-C-kontakt som inte kickar igång om man kör USB-C till USB-C direkt med en riktig USB-C till C-kabel. De korten funkar däremot korrekt om man kopplar till USB 3.x och äldre, även tex en enkel usbhubb imellan. De här äldre korten missade jag lite på, de "pratade" inte korrekt uppströms om spänningsmatningen om det var riktig USB-C i andra änden. _________________ Magnus Thomé |
||||||||
Att cadda kort är som att meditera. Så jag bestämde mig för ett nytt mål, ett nytt så litet kort som jag öht kan. Och för att kunna komma lite längre i förminskningen, mitt första fyrlagerskort. Jag trodde det skulle vara sjukt mycket dyrare men det är det ju inte numera, kul. Så det blev komponenter monterade på båda sidor och fyrlagers. Jag valde den nyare ESP32-C6 som har två CAN controllers inbyggda! Bonus är Wifi6 och Zigbee/Matter. Det är en omgång på tio kort på G från JLCPCB om någon dryg vecka.
Med två CAN-portar så är tanken att man kan göra kul "Man In The Middle"grejer. På samma sätt som jag gjorde växelindikators- HUD till M2'an där jag åt ena hållet hämtade varvtal o hastighet med mera från bilen och på andra CAN-porten skickade upp uträknat vilken växel DCT-lådan var i men som ODB2-hastighet, dvs 1kmh = växel ett osv. Så visade den inköpta OBD2 HUDen växel fast den trodde den visade hastighet. Samma med olje o vattentemp. Tanken är att kunna tex koppla in sig mellan bilen och instrumentkluster och då kunna visa oljetemp på valbar annan mätare. Tex trycka på en knapp så visas oljetemp på hastighetsmätaren eller bara helt enkelt att vattentempmätare eller odometer kan visa oljetemp istället. Osv. Tyvärr är Porschen inte CAN-baserad, den är bara något år eller två för gammal AFAIK. Jag får väl leka med Pegg108'an Lekstuga? Javisst! _________________ Magnus Thomé |
||||||||
Fick ett ryck och provade en USB-A -> USB-C, funkade.
Demonterade OBD2 kontakten och ser att jag lött på kraftjorden till sensorjorden, verkar ha hittat en dålig pinout förra gången helt enkelt. Drog in Serial log sketchen och gick ut i bilen, det kommer saker på serieporten i alla fall, ser det vettigt ut? Massa hex ser dert väl ut som? _________________ /Mats Strandberg onemanracing.com BMW 330i -05 |
||||||||
Får hit tio kort inom nån dag nu om herrn är intresserad av ett (om de nu funkar o inget fel smugit sig in ) _________________ Magnus Thomé |
||||||||
You bet! _________________ /Mats Strandberg onemanracing.com BMW 330i -05 |
||||||||
Hade inget bättre för mig och tycker att cadda riktigt små kort är lite som att meditera så jag caddade ihop ett sandwichmonterat dotterkort med två CAN FD på. Så man har två CAN portar på huvudkortet plus två CAN FD portar på dotterkortet. I en liten volym som 35mm x 25mm x 20mm som alltså är mindre än den OBD2-dongle du har nu med gamla kortet. Sen så kanske man inte ska försöka hantera alla paket på alla bussarna samtidigt, kanske blir lite tungt för proppen Hursom så är det inte ett kort jag tänkt få tillverkat några av som det är nu, det var en CAD-övning bara än så länge. Fast lite sugen att se sina kort i verkligheten är det ju alltid _________________ Magnus Thomé |
||||||||
Får bygga en stege, först en ESP med två CAN kort in och ett ut, sen ett likadant brevid. De plockar in fyra bussar totalt och skyfflar vidare två, som går in i rejsakortet...
Fast skulle inte ESP32-C3 professorn orka fyra linor? Det är väl inte så tungrott? Fast nu gäller det att få igång CAN sniffer och lära sig identifiera adresser och värden. Vore ju smakfullt om man kunde logga lite för att se hur det beter sig. _________________ /Mats Strandberg onemanracing.com BMW 330i -05 |
||||||||
Om hård- och mjukvara för loggning & video RejsaCAN datorkort 3x5cm, CAN-bus, 12V, bluetooth, WiFi | << 1, 2, 3, 4 >> 2 besök senaste veckan (2964 totalt) |